Transaction 879937f7a5420578e61cba429fcdf656e8d6010ee3581908d79ab320884e033a
1 Input
1 Output
-
879937f7a5420578e61cba429fcdf656e8d6010ee3581908d79ab320884e033a:0
- value
- 4999700
- script pubkey
- OP_0 OP_PUSHBYTES_32 ce8fb502b67cf30b3c37e7ef27fe592a570929f36d8647bbf7d7eb1dfff0e687
- address
- bc1qe68m2q4k0nesk0phulhj0lje9ftsj20ndkry0wlh6l43mllsu6rsq2ttsj